In a thrilling matchup that kept fans on the edge of their seats, #24 Florida Atlantic University emerged victorious over the University of Alabama at Birmingham with a final score of 86-73. Dominant Performance by Florida Atlantic

From the opening tip-off, Florida Atlantic displayed a level of intensity and skill that set the tone for the entire game. The players showcased their offensive prowess with a barrage of well-executed plays, and their defense proved to be a formidable force against UAB’s attempts to score. FAU went into halftime with a 43-24 lead.

Star Players Shine

Individual performances played a crucial role in Florida Atlantic’s success. Key players stepped up to the challenge, making significant contributions on both ends of the court. Whether it was a three-pointer from beyond the arc, a crucial steal, or a powerful slam dunk, each player’s efforts were instrumental in securing the victory. FAU guard Johnell Davis had 30 poinys with eight rebounds, Vladislav Goldin had 18 points with five rebounds, with Bryan Greenlee overall effort with seven rebounds, five assists, with four points and Jalen Gaffney had 10 points seven rebounds and four assists.

UAB’s Resilience

While the final score may suggest a one-sided affair, the University of Alabama at Birmingham exhibited resilience and determination. Despite facing a formidable opponent, UAB fought hard, showcasing their own moments of brilliance and keeping the game competitive. The team’s efforts deserve commendation, as they never gave up and continued to push back against the pressure imposed by Florida Atlantic. Eric Gaines and Efrem Johnson lead the way for the Blazers with 13 points each.
